Lista completa de Questões sobre Banco de Dados para resolução totalmente grátis. Selecione os assuntos no filtro de questões e comece a resolver exercícios.
Em um banco de dados relacional, qual é o tipo de relacionamento que não é passível de implementação, sendo necessário criar-se uma nova entidade entre as duas entidades que ora se relacionam?
Relacionamento 1:1 (um para um)
Relacionamento 1: N (um para muitos)
Relacionamento N:N (muitos para muitos)
Todos os tipos de relacionamentos são diretamente implementáveis
Todos os tipos de relacionamentos são diretamente implementáveis
Em relação a um banco de dados relacional, analise as afirmativas abaixo e marque a alternativa correspondente:
I. Integridade referencial é um mecanismo utilizado pelos gerenciadores de bancos de dados para manter a consistência das informações armazenadas.
II. A principal forma de garantir a integridade entre tabelas se dá por meio do vínculo entre a chave primária de uma tabela com a chave estrangeira da outra tabela.
III. Integridade referencial é um mecanismo utilizado pelos programadores de computador para manter a consistência das informações armazenadas.
Está(ão) correta(s) apenas a(s) afirmativa(s):
I
II
III
I e II
II e III
Em um banco de dados relacional, grupos de dados estão na 3ª Forma Normal quando:
Estiverem na 2ª Forma Normal e forem eliminados os grupos de dados repetitivos da estrutura.
Estiverem na 2ª Forma Normal e forem localizados dados que não dependam única e exclusivamente da chave da entidade.
Estiverem na 2ª Forma Normal e atributos com dependência transitiva forem localizados.
Estiverem na 1ª Forma Normal e forem eliminados os grupos de dados repetitivos da estrutura
Estiverem na 1ª Forma Normal e forem localizados dados que não dependam única e exclusivamente da chave da entidade.
Analise as seguintes afirmações relacionadas a conceitos e funções de gerenciadores de banco de dados.
I. Em um banco de dados relacional, os dados e os relacionamentos entre os dados são representados por uma coleção de tabelas, cada uma com seus dados e índices únicos.
II. A chave primária é um ou mais atributos cujo valor identifica unicamente uma Tupla entre todas as outras de uma entidade. Deve ter conteúdo reduzido e valor constante no tempo.
III. Procedimentos gravados, que são executados automaticamente quando ocorre determinada ação do usuário, são denominados Tuplas.
IV. O MER (Modelo de Entidade e Relacionamento) é parte do aplicativo que manipula os dados e capta as informações para o usuário. Um MER deve ser estruturado para permitir navegação intuitiva e fácil.
Indique a opção que contenha todas as afirmações verdadeiras.
I e II
II e III
III e IV
I e III
II e IV
Ciência da Computação - Banco de Dados - Centro de Seleção e de Promoção de Eventos UnB (CESPE) - 2006
De acordo com Avi Silberschatz, o modelo entidaderelacionamento (ER) é uma notação para modelagem conceitual de bancos de dados cujas principais características são: utilização de poucos conceitos, boa representação gráfica e facilidade de compreensão. Acerca do projeto conceitual de banco de dados e do modelo ER, julgue os itens subseqüentes. O projeto conceitual de um banco de dados descreve detalhadamente a estrutura do banco de dados, com todas as informações necessárias para sua implementação direta em um sistema de gerência de banco de dados específico.
Analise as seguintes afirmações relacionadas a conceitos de Sistemas de Gerenciamento de Banco de Dados.
I. O LOCK é um mecanismo usado para controlar o acesso aos dados em um sistema multiusuário. Ele previne que o mesmo dado seja alterado por dois usuários simultaneamente ou que a tabela seja alterada em sua estrutura enquanto os dados estão sendo modifi cados.
II. Os bloqueios de registros gastam mais memória que bloqueios em páginas ou tabelas, mas permitem bloquear um único registro por um longo tempo.
III. O LOCK de tabela ocorre quando o sistema entra em estado de DeadLock e, em seguida, executa um COMMIT para sair do referido estado.
IV. O comando SQL responsável por fechar uma transação confirmando as operações feitas é o INSERT. Para desfazer todas as operações o comando a ser utilizado é o DROP.
Indique a opção que contenha todas as afirmações verdadeiras.
I e II
II e III
III e IV
I e III
II e IV
Das atribuições relacionadas abaixo, marque aquela que não corresponde à função de Administrador de Banco de Dados.
Planejamento e levantamento de requisitos para análise de dados.
Concessão de autorização para acesso aos dados.
Definição de Controles de Integridade.
Execução de Rotinas de Desempenho.
Definição da estrutura de Armazenamento e métodos de acesso.
Baseado no Diagrama abaixo, marque a opção correta.
I NÃO corresponte adequadamente à tabela Pessoa do diagrama.
II NÃO corresponde adequadamente à tabela Endereço ao diagrama.
I e II correspondem adequadamente ao mostrado no diagrama.
I e III correspondem adequadamente ao mostrado no diagrama.
todas opções apresentadas (I, II, III) são válidas para representar adequadamente o diagrama.
Ciência da Computação - Banco de Dados - Centro de Seleção e de Promoção de Eventos UnB (CESPE) - 2006
Banco de dados distribuído é uma coleção de múltiplos bancos de dados inter-relacionados distribuídos sobre uma rede de computadores. Acerca de sistemas de bancos de dados distribuídos, julgue o seguinte item. A replicação de dados em um ambiente de banco de dados distribuído é altamente recomendável para fins de confiabilidade do sistema, mas impõe uma série de problemas relacionados à consistência e ao desempenho, pois requerem mecanismos especiais de controle de atualizações.
São modelos de Banco de Dados:
modelo de relacionamentos, modelo de redes e modelo hierárquico.
modelo de relacionamentos, modelo piramidal e modelo matricial.
modelo relacional, modelo de redes e modelo hierárquico.
modelo relacional, modelo piramidal e modelo matricial.
{TITLE}
{CONTENT}
{TITLE}
Aguarde, enviando solicitação...